Improved Mobility and Independence

One of the primary advantages of a leather lift recliner is its ability to enhance mobility. These recliners are specifically designed to assist individuals with limited mobility. The lifting mechanism can gently elevate the seat, enabling a smoother transition from sitting to standing. This feature is especially beneficial for the elderly or those recovering from surgery, as it reduces the risk of falls and provides the necessary support to maintain independence.

Durability and Long-term Investment

Leather is known for its durability and resistance to wear and tear, making a leather lift recliner a worthwhile investment. Unlike fabric upholstery, leather is less prone to staining and can be cleaned easily, maintaining its appearance over time. When you choose a quality leather lift recliner, you are not only investing in immediate comfort but also in a long-lasting piece of furniture that can withstand everyday use.

Key Features to Look For

When shopping for a leather lift recliner with heat and massage, certain features can enhance your experience. Look for adjustable settings for both heating and massaging functions, allowing you to customize the intensity according to your preferences. Some models offer specific massage modes, such as kneading or rolling, which can provide targeted relief, enhancing the overall therapeutic benefit.

Assessing Your Space and Needs

Before making a purchase, consider the space where the recliner will be placed. Measure your room to ensure that the recliner fits comfortably without overwhelming the area. Additionally, evaluate who will be using the recliner. If it will primarily be for an elderly family member, prioritize ease of use and safety features, such as side pockets for remote storage or a built-in emergency button.

How to Properly Maintain Your Leather Lift Recliner with Heat and Massage

Proper maintenance is vital to ensure that your leather lift recliner retains its look and functionality over the years. Here are some essential maintenance tips to keep your recliner in excellent condition:

Regular Cleaning Tips

Regularly dust your recliner to prevent dirt buildup. Use a damp cloth for cleaning, ensuring you dry the leather afterward. Avoid using harsh chemicals that can damage the finish. Instead, opt for specialized leather cleaners that nourish and protect the material.

Caring for Leather Material

To maintain the integrity of the leather, apply a leather conditioner every six months. This routine helps to prevent cracking and fading, keeping your recliner looking fresh. Pay special attention to areas of high wear, like the armrests and seat, to ensure even conditioning.

Ensuring Optimal Functionality

Check the recliner’s mechanisms regularly to ensure that they are functioning correctly. Lubricate moving parts if necessary and keep the electronic components free of dust. If you notice any unusual sounds or jerking while using the recliner, contact a professional for assistance to avoid further damage.

Frequently Asked Questions about Leather Lift Recliners with Heat and Massage

What is the average lifespan of a leather lift recliner?

The average lifespan can vary, but with proper care, a leather lift recliner can last between 10 to 15 years, making it a durable investment.

Are heat and massage features adjustable?

Most modern leather lift recliners allow users to adjust heat and massage settings, offering customizable comfort according to personal preferences.

How do I clean the leather on my recliner?

Use a soft, damp cloth to wipe the leather surface, then dry it thoroughly. For deeper cleaning, consider using a leather-specific conditioner.

Can I use a lift recliner if I have mobility issues?

Yes, leather lift recliners are specifically designed to assist those with mobility challenges, helping them transition smoothly between sitting and standing.

What are the warranty options for such recliners?

Warranty options vary by manufacturer, but many leather lift recliners come with warranties ranging from one to five years, covering defects in materials and workmanship.
